To determine which graph shows a proportional relationship, we need to look for a pattern where the ratio between the x-values and the y-values remains constant.

Let's analyze each graph:

A. In graph A, when we calculate the ratio of the y-values to the corresponding x-values, we get 4/3, 7/5, and 8.5/6, which are not equal. Therefore, graph A does not show a proportional relationship.

B. In graph B, when we calculate the ratio of the y-values to the corresponding x-values, we get 2/1, 4/2, 8/4, and 12/6. These ratios are all equal to 2. Therefore, graph B shows a proportional relationship.

C. In graph C, when we calculate the ratio of the y-values to the corresponding x-values, we get 5/2, 8/4, and 10/6. These ratios are not equal. Therefore, graph C does not show a proportional relationship.

D. The details of graph D are not provided, so we cannot determine if it shows a proportional relationship based on the information given.

Based on the analysis, graph B shows a proportional relationship, so the answer is B.
